South Maui should be a safe walkable, bikeable community

6/7/25 #kihei #transportation #bicycle For decades KCA has been advocating for our district to have safe walking and cycling. Sidewalks are promised and required, but never constructed. Bike paths get lip service by County government, but do not get constructed.  SEE https://gokihei.org/environment/kca-again-proposes-a-safe-bike-path-in-kihei  https://gokihei.org/environment/the-next-bike-path-for-kihei-waipuilani...

Final week to apply for affordable rental housing in central Kihei, Last day is Friday the 13th

  6/6/25 #kihei # housing The deadline for applicants to be entered into the lottery for the Hale O Piikea I affordable rental units is June 13th at 5:00 PM.  Applicants must submit their applications by then to be entered into the lottery. The lottery will be conducted on June 20th in the morning. Applications can be found on the project website: https://mdihawaii.com/rentals/hale-o-piikea-phase-1/.     Applications received after Friday, June 13, 2025, 5:00 p.m. will be...
